ANNUAL FEES

Thorhild County has funded FREE library cards for ALL residents of Thorhild County!

Our county libraries join over 90 public libraries in Alberta that are not charging for library cards    

BORROWING INFORMATION

Library cards may only be used by the person to whom it is issued. Please notify the library immediately of any change of address or telephone number, or if a card is lost.

Proper care of the library item entrusted to your care is expected. Should any item be damaged, defaced, or lost you shall be expected to pay the replacement (list) cost of the item to the library.

No more than five items may be on loan to one person at any given time.

Books, DVD's magazines, etc are lent for a period of 21 days.  Though we no longer charge fines, we encourage a donation to the "Jar of Shame" should your conscience be assailed.

Reference services or requests for Interlibrary Loans ideally should be addressed to this library as it is your home library.

If $10.00 is owing by a patron or a member of any family unit (all members of one household) ALL members of that family  will be refused service.

Children under the age of 12 years must have their application form signed by his or her parent or guardian.

The membership card remains the property of the Thorhild Library and may be revoked at any time if any of the above conditions are violated.
